The process of machining a valve block for fluid control involves several steps to ensure precision and functionality. Firstly, a detailed design is created, taking into account the required specifications and dimensions. This design is then translated into a computer-aided design (CAD) software, which generates a digital model of the valve block. Next, the CAD model is used to program a computer numerical control (CNC) machine, which will carry out the machining process. The CNC machine precisely cuts and shapes the valve block from a solid block of material, such as aluminum or stainless steel, using various cutting tools and techniques. This process involves milling, drilling, and tapping to create the necessary holes, channels, and threads for fluid flow and control. Once the machining is complete, the valve block undergoes rigorous quality checks to ensure it meets the desired specifications, including dimensional accuracy, surface finish, and tight tolerances. Finally, the valve block is cleaned, deburred, and prepared for assembly, where it will be integrated into a larger fluid control system. Overall, the machining process for a valve block requires expertise, precision, and attention to detail to produce a high-quality component for efficient fluid control.
